Tech Sales Manager information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a tech sales manager?

To thrive as a Tech Sales Manager, you need strong sales acumen, leadership abilities, and a solid understanding of technology solutions, often supported by a bachelor’s degree in business or a related field. Familiarity with CRM software like Salesforce, sales analytics tools, and relevant industry certifications such as Certified Professional Sales Leader (CPSL) are typically required. Exceptional communication, negotiation, and strategic thinking skills help build client relationships and motivate sales teams. These competencies are essential to drive sales growth, meet targets, and maintain a competitive edge in the technology sector.

What are some common challenges tech sales managers face when leading a sales team?

Tech Sales Managers often navigate challenges such as keeping up with rapidly evolving technology products, managing a team with varying levels of technical expertise, and aligning sales strategies with company goals. Building strong relationships with both clients and internal technical teams is crucial, as is ensuring the team stays motivated in a highly competitive market. Effective communication and ongoing training are key to overcoming these challenges and driving consistent sales performance.

What is the difference between Tech Sales Manager vs Tech Account Executive?

AspectTech Sales ManagerTech Account Executive
Primary RoleOversees sales teams, develops sales strategies, manages client relationships at a managerial levelBuilds client relationships, closes sales, manages individual accounts
Required SkillsLeadership, strategic planning, team management, technical knowledgeSales techniques, technical product knowledge, client communication
Work EnvironmentSales teams, management meetings, strategic planning sessionsClient sites, sales presentations, product demonstrations
Common UsageUsed by companies to describe managerial sales roles in techUsed to describe direct sales roles focused on client acquisition

The main difference is that Tech Sales Managers focus on leading sales teams and developing strategies, while Tech Account Executives focus on closing sales and managing individual client accounts. Both roles require technical knowledge and sales skills but differ in scope and responsibilities.

Is tech sales high-paying?

Tech sales managers often earn high salaries, especially with experience and performance-based commissions. Base pay can range from $70,000 to over $150,000 annually, with top performers earning significantly more through bonuses and incentives. Strong communication skills and technical knowledge of products are important for success in this role.

What does a tech sales manager do?

A tech sales manager oversees the sales team responsible for selling technology products or services. They develop sales strategies, set targets, manage client relationships, and coordinate with marketing and product teams to meet revenue goals. Strong communication, technical knowledge, and leadership skills are essential for success in this role.
